Senior Go Developer with GCP

Sorry, this position is no longer available
We are looking for a Senior Go Developer to join our remote team and execute the IAS Backend migration plan.
In this role, you will be responsible for designing, developing, and deploying containerized applications on cloud platforms, particularly on Google Cloud Platform. You will need to be an expert in Go Language and have a solid understanding of SQL, Database, and Cloud API development and invocation. Additionally, you should have experience in media processing, especially videos.
Responsibilities
- Execute the IAS Backend migration plan to serve existing and future IAS customers
- Design, develop, and deploy containerized applications on cloud platforms, particularly on Google Cloud Platform
- Implement microservices architecture for the IAS Backend
- Collaborate with cross-functional teams to ensure seamless project completion
- Troubleshoot and debug issues related to the IAS Backend
- Contribute to the continuous improvement of the development processes and methodologies
- Participate in code review, testing, and deployment activities
Requirements
- At least 3 years of experience in software development, with experience in Go Language
- Experience in designing and implementing microservices architecture
- Solid understanding of Cloud Platforms, particularly Google Cloud Platform, and Google Cloud APIs
- Strong understanding of SQL and Databases
- Experience in developing and deploying containerized applications on cloud platforms
- Experience in media processing, especially videos
- Excellent analytical, problem-solving, and troubleshooting skills
- Excellent communication skills, both verbal and written, in English language
- Ability to work independently and in a team, with a proactive and self-motivated attitude
Nice to have
- Experience with Protocol Buffers and gRPC
Benefits
- International projects with top brands
- Work with global teams of highly skilled, diverse peers
- Healthcare benefits
- Employee financial programs
- Paid time off and sick leave
- Upskilling, reskilling and certification courses
- Unlimited access to the LinkedIn Learning library and 22,000+ courses
- Global career opportunities
- Volunteer and community involvement opportunities
- EPAM Employee Groups
-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n